Market Size and Trends
The Autonomous Data Platform market is estimated to be valued at USD 4.2 billion in 2025 and is expected to reach USD 11.8 billion by 2032, growing at a compound annual growth rate (CAGR) of 16.4% from 2025 to 2032. This significant growth reflects increasing adoption of AI-driven data management solutions across industries, driven by the need for enhanced data accuracy, scalability, and operational efficiency in managing large volumes of complex data.
Key market trends include the rising integration of artificial intelligence and machine learning capabilities within autonomous data platforms, enabling real-time data processing and predictive analytics. Additionally, enterprises are increasingly embracing cloud-based autonomous data solutions to leverage flexibility, cost savings, and faster deployment. Growing demand for automated data governance and compliance, coupled with advancements in edge computing, further accelerates the platform's adoption, positioning it as a critical enabler for digital transformation initiatives worldwide.
Segmental Analysis:
By Platform Type: Real-Time Data Processing Leading Due to Demand for Instant Insights and Agility
In terms of By Platform Type, Real-time Data Processing contributes the highest share of the market owing to the growing imperative for organizations to harness immediate data insights for quick decision-making and operational efficiency. The increasing volume of data generated by digital transactions, IoT devices, and user interactions necessitates platforms capable of processing information in milliseconds or seconds, enabling businesses to act on real-world events without delay. Real-time data platforms support use cases such as fraud detection in financial transactions, dynamic pricing, and personalized customer experiences, driving their adoption across various sectors. The shift towards digital transformation and the need for agility in response to market changes further propel the demand for real-time capabilities. Additionally, advancements in streaming technologies and distributed computing infrastructures have enhanced the scalability and reliability of real-time data processing, making these platforms more accessible and cost-effective. Hybrid platforms, although significant, often complement rather than replace real-time systems by combining batch and stream processing. Cloud-based solutions, while popular, serve diverse requirements but have not outpaced specialized real-time platforms in sectors where low latency and immediate analytics are critical. Overall, the increasing reliance on data-driven, rapid decision-making frameworks is the core driver reinforcing the dominance of real-time data processing within autonomous data platforms.
By Deployment Mode: On-Premises Dominates Due to Security and Control Demands
By Deployment Mode, On-Premises solutions hold the highest share of the autonomous data platform market primarily because enterprises prioritize data security, regulatory compliance, and greater control over their critical infrastructure. Many organizations, particularly in sectors with stringent data privacy regulations or sensitive information, prefer to retain their data management within their own data centers. On-premises deployment provides a tailored environment meeting specific governance and security protocols that cloud or hybrid offerings may not fully guarantee. Furthermore, legacy systems and existing IT investments often influence the preference for on-premises platforms, as organizations can leverage current infrastructure while integrating autonomous capabilities. Customization and performance optimization achievable through on-premises setups appeal to industry verticals with intensive workloads or specialized operational needs. Although cloud deployment has gained ground due to flexibility and scalability, concerns related to data breaches, regulatory constraints, and network latency continue to steer many enterprises toward on-premises solutions. Hybrid deployment models are emerging to bridge gaps between local control and cloud agility but currently serve as a complement rather than a replacement. Edge deployments, though growing in niche use cases, remain limited compared to traditional on-premises setups. The overall emphasis on safeguarding data and maintaining operational sovereignty predominantly drives the sustained leadership of on-premises deployment within autonomous data platforms.
By End-User Industry: BFSI Leads Driven by High Data Sensitivity and Need for Automation
By End-User Industry, the BFSI (Banking, Financial Services, and Insurance) segment commands the largest share of the autonomous data platform market due to the sector's acute emphasis on data accuracy, security, and automation to manage vast volumes of transactions and compliance requirements. The BFSI industry faces continuous regulatory scrutiny and operational risks, making autonomous data platforms critical for automating data management, ensuring data integrity, and enabling real-time analytics for fraud detection, risk assessment, and customer personalization. The implementation of AI and machine learning models in financial services further fuels the demand for platforms capable of processing dynamic, complex datasets with minimal human intervention. Moreover, the drive to enhance customer experience through personalized services and rapid response times adds to the reliance on autonomous data solutions. Compared to other industries like healthcare or manufacturing, BFSI exhibits a more immediate and widespread adoption owing to the critical need for rapid, reliable insights and the protection of sensitive financial data. Emerging technologies such as blockchain integration and open banking also create opportunities for autonomous platforms to streamline data processes. While sectors like IT & Telecom and Retail & E-commerce are significant users of such platforms, the BFSI industry's combination of stringent compliance mandates and innovation focus solidifies its position as the leading end-user segment in this market.
Regional Insights:
Dominating Region: North America
In North America, the dominance in the Autonomous Data Platform market is primarily driven by a mature technology ecosystem and strong presence of industry-leading companies specializing in cloud computing, AI, and data management. The region benefits from substantial investment in R&D by key players such as Google, Microsoft, IBM, and Snowflake, which continuously innovate and enhance autonomous data solutions. Furthermore, favorable government policies supporting digital transformation, data privacy frameworks, and infrastructure expansion create an enabling environment. The region also hosts numerous large enterprises across banking, healthcare, and retail sectors, which adopt autonomous data platforms to improve operational efficiency and data-driven decision-making. Additionally, North America's well-established trade networks and partnerships facilitate rapid deployment and integration of cutting-edge data technologies.
Fastest-Growing Region: Asia Pacific
Meanwhile, the Asia Pacific region exhibits the fastest growth due to accelerating digitalization across emerging economies, increasing cloud adoption, and strong government initiatives aimed at fostering technological innovation. Countries like China, India, and South Korea are heavily investing in autonomous data platforms as part of broader smart city, Industry 4.0, and AI strategies. The expanding startup ecosystem and presence of local technology champions such as Alibaba Cloud, Baidu, and Infosys contribute significantly by offering tailored autonomous data solutions that suit the region's unique business requirements. Additionally, government incentives, policies promoting data sovereignty, and growing demand from sectors like manufacturing, telecommunications, and e-commerce fuel rapid market expansion across Asia Pacific. Trade dynamics including cross-border data flows and regional cooperation agreements further accelerate adoption.
Autonomous Data Platform Market Outlook for Key Countries
United States
The United States' market remains the largest and most advanced globally, with major cloud providers like Microsoft Azure, Amazon Web Services (AWS), and Google Cloud dominating the landscape. These companies invest heavily in autonomous data technologies incorporating AI and machine learning to optimize data integration, processing, and analytics. The US government's emphasis on digital infrastructure and data security, combined with a high concentration of enterprises in finance, healthcare, and tech sectors, sustains strong demand and continuous innovation in the autonomous data platform domain.
China
China's market is rapidly expanding, spurred by the nation's comprehensive digital strategy focused on AI, big data, and cloud computing. Leading domestic companies such as Alibaba Cloud, Tencent Cloud, and Huawei are key drivers in offering highly scalable autonomous data platforms tailored for local regulations and industry needs. Government policies including data localization laws and substantial investment in infrastructure and smart manufacturing projects underpin growth. The emphasis on technological self-reliance also promotes indigenous innovations in autonomous data solutions.
India
India's autonomous data platform market is gaining momentum through accelerating digital transformation initiatives across both private and public sectors. Companies like Infosys, TCS, and Wipro actively develop and implement autonomous data solutions mainly targeting banking, telecommunications, and government services. The government's push towards Digital India and increased cloud adoption by SMEs supports broader deployment. India's burgeoning startup ecosystem also fosters innovation and drives competitive offerings within the autonomous data platform space.
Germany
Germany continues to lead Europe's autonomous data platform market, thanks to its strong industrial base and early adoption of Industry 4.0 initiatives. Established technology firms such as SAP and Siemens are pivotal in developing autonomous data technologies tailored for manufacturing, automotive, and logistics sectors. Supportive government policies focused on data security, privacy, and digital innovation accelerate adoption. Germany's position as a European technology hub facilitates cross-border collaboration and strengthens its market dominance in autonomous data platforms.
Japan
Japan's market reflects steady advancement driven by deep integration of autonomous data platforms in automotive, electronics, and healthcare industries. Companies like Hitachi, Fujitsu, and NEC are notable contributors, leveraging AI-driven data automation to enhance operational efficiencies. Government initiatives promoting Society 5.0 and smart infrastructure bolster digital innovation. Japan's focus on precision technologies and quality standards ensures continuous evolution of autonomous data capabilities within its enterprises.
